Présentation de l'entreprise

Senmiao Technology Limited operates within the industrials sector, specifically functioning in the rental and leasing services industry, where it engages in automobile transaction and related services within the People's Republic of China. The company's core activities encompass providing car rental services to individual customers, offering auto finance solutions through financing leases, and engaging in automobile sales. As a small-cap entity, the company currently holds a market capitalization of $5.79M, supported by an annual revenue of $3.13M and a workforce of 35 employees. Santé financière

The company reported a trailing twelve-month revenue of $3.13M, yet this figure masks a significant operational challenge as the net income for the same period was -$4,088,703, resulting in a loss that exceeds the total revenue generated. This substantial gap between revenue and net income reveals a highly leveraged cost structure where operating expenses and likely interest obligations far outweigh the gross profits generated from leasing and sales activities. The enterprise generates an EBITDA of -$3,974,467, indicating that even before interest and taxes, the core business operations are not self-sustaining. Furthermore, the free cash flow stands at -$4,550,194, which signifies a severe lack of financial flexibility as the company is burning cash rather than accumulating liquidity to fund organic growth or weather economic downturns. Despite these negative earnings, the balance sheet shows a cash balance of $3.51M against total debt of $199,504, creating a theoretical cushion that is eroded by the massive operating losses. However, the debt-to-equity ratio of 5.26 suggests a highly leveraged capital structure where equity holders bear disproportionate risk relative to the debt burden. The operating margin is reported at -305.7%, while the profit margin is -115.7%, and the gross margin sits at 19.7%, illustrating that for every dollar of sales, the company loses money on a net and operating basis despite retaining nearly 20 cents of gross profit before overheads. The current ratio of 2.24 indicates that the company possesses sufficient short-term assets to cover its short-term liabilities, suggesting that immediate liquidity solvency is not the primary threat despite the cash burn. Finally, the return on equity is -135.7% and the return on assets is -44.6%, metrics that reveal a profound lack of management effectiveness in generating value for shareholders or utilizing the asset base productively.

À propos de Senmiao Technology Limited

Senmiao Technology Limited engages in the automobile transaction and related services business in the People's Republic of China. It also provides car rental services to individual customers; and auto finance solutions through financing leases. In addition, the company engages in automobile sales comprising sale of new purchased or used cars; and the provision of supporting services. Further, the company offers new energy vehicles leasing, automobile purchase, and management services, such as ride-hailing driver training, and assisting with a series of administrative procedures, as well as credit assessment, installation of GPS devices, ride-hailing driver qualification, and other administrative procedures. Senmiao Technology Limited was founded in 2014 and is based in Chengdu, the People's Republic of China.
